Transaction 74db9737e338dd3124c8d2a98784d137c1c96a8436b7d914ee1b572ecb186f10

1 Input
1 Outputs
  • 74db9737e338dd3124c8d2a98784d137c1c96a8436b7d914ee1b572ecb186f10:0
  • value  3497402
    address  325HAoUUy3sGGjM29ff3wbYRhAgy5zpWKi